Chevy Stewart is averaging 9 fantasy points from 1 game for the Canberra Raiders this season. His top score for the year is 42 and he scored 9 in his most recent game.
Across the season he is averaging 0 tackles and 58 run metres a game.
Stewart's break even is 28, at a current price of $237k. A break even is the score a player needs to reach for his price to hold. Scores above it push the price up and scores below it pull the price down.
Stewart is priced at $237k in NRL Fantasy. His starting price this season was $250k and he has fallen $13k since.
Players at that price are usually picked for price growth rather than their week to week scoring. He is currently owned by 1% of NRL Fantasy teams.
Stewart and the Canberra Raiders next face the Penrith Panthers in Round 22.
After that the Canberra Raiders have the Newcastle Knights and then the Cronulla Sharks.
